    Post by vis Wed Oct 10 2012, 06:00

    I have to agree with Ion here. Let's be honest like him or tolerate him Defoe is what we have had up front to start the season with. A run of games that has seen us unbeaten since the opener. So credit were it is due for Defoe. I like him, so that's that out the way lol. In fact I prefer him to Adabayor. I have never seen Defoe as a "lone striker" type but he has helped us start the season on a reasonably steady footing. More someone who thrives off a partner, or more so off a player in the hole. As yet Dempsey hasn't fully settled into the team but could well be that sort of player to assist Defoe's game. Yes Defoe can be more like a cricketer at times and more interested in his own stats, but that has always been his game. He has been an able servant for the club over the years. Maybe he should score more and he certainly should not be caught offside as often as he is but to knock him is to take away what he does bring to the team which is uncertainty in the opposistion defence about what he may do and this can benefit other Spurs players in a game. I do agree that Adabayor seems more able to hold the ball up and bring in other players with a deft touch but at times this affects one of our most potent weapons. The speed of our counter-attacks. I hope Defoe stays and I hope he forges good goal scoring partnerships with the likes of Adabayor & Dempsey and I won't overly criticise him because if nothing else you can see he loves our club . . . ..
